Understanding the University Application Timeline for 2025 Entry

Applying to university for the 2025 academic year requires careful planning and a proactive approach. The ideal application timeline varies depending on your chosen universities and their specific deadlines. However, a general framework can help you stay on track. This guide will cover key deadlines and essential steps to ensure a smooth application process.

Key Deadlines to Keep in Mind

Early Action/Early Decision: Many universities offer early action or early decision programs. These programs often have deadlines as early as November or December 2024. Early action allows you to apply early without binding yourself to the university if accepted. Early decision, however, is binding – if accepted, you must attend. Research if these options align with your plans.

Regular Decision: The regular decision application deadline typically falls between January and February 2025. This is the standard application deadline for most universities. Plan to submit your application well before the deadline to avoid last-minute stress.

Rolling Admissions: Some universities offer rolling admissions, meaning they review applications as they are received. While there's often a final deadline, applying earlier increases your chances of receiving a decision sooner. Check each university's individual policy.

Essential Steps Before You Apply

Before diving into applications, several crucial steps will streamline the process:

1. Research Universities and Programs:

  • Start early: Ideally begin researching potential universities and programs in the summer or fall of 2024.
  • Consider factors: Location, program offerings, campus culture, and overall fit are crucial considerations.
  • Visit campuses (if possible): Visiting potential universities offers valuable insights into the campus environment.

2. Prepare Your Academic Records:

  • Transcripts: Request official transcripts from your high school well in advance of deadlines.
  • Standardized Tests: Determine if you need to take the SAT or ACT and register for the test dates accordingly. Aim to complete testing by the fall of 2024 to allow for score reporting. Check university requirements carefully, as some are test-optional.

3. Craft a Compelling Application:

  • Personal Essay: Begin drafting your personal essay during the fall of 2024. Allow ample time for revisions and feedback.
  • Letters of Recommendation: Request letters of recommendation from teachers or counselors well in advance (ideally by fall 2024). Give them plenty of notice and the necessary information.
  • Extracurricular Activities: Highlight your extracurricular involvement and achievements in your application. Keep detailed records of your activities.

4. Financial Planning:

  • FAFSA/CSS Profile: Complete the FAFSA (Free Application for Federal Student Aid) and CSS Profile (College Scholarship Service Profile) as early as possible, often opening in October or November 2024. This will determine your financial aid eligibility.
  • Scholarships: Begin researching and applying for scholarships as soon as possible. Many have deadlines well before university applications.

When Should YOU Apply? A Personalized Approach

The optimal application time depends on your individual circumstances:

  • Strong Academic Record & Early Decision: If you have a strong academic record and are confident in your application, consider early decision to increase your chances of acceptance at your top-choice university.
  • Need More Time to Prepare: If you need more time to prepare your application materials, such as standardized test scores or essays, applying during the regular decision period is perfectly acceptable. Don't rush the process to meet an arbitrary deadline.
  • Rolling Admissions: If you're applying to universities with rolling admissions, the sooner you apply, the sooner you might receive a decision.
